Afternoon Adventures in Alsace
As the day warms to a comfortable 74°F by noon, it’s time to venture beyond Basel’s borders on the Fairy-Tale Villages & Wine Tour. Departing at 8:00 AM and returning by 6:00 PM, this enchanting journey takes you through the picturesque Alsace region, where fairy-tale villages await. Begin in Eguisheim, a village renowned for its colorful half-timbered houses and winding streets. Here, you’ll have the opportunity to explore at your leisure, perhaps stopping to sample local wines or indulge in a traditional Alsatian lunch.
The tour continues to Colmar, often referred to as “Little Venice” for its charming canals and medieval architecture. As you wander through this storybook town, you’ll be transported to another era, surrounded by the vibrant colors and rich history that define the Alsace region. The final stop is Riquewihr, where a wine tasting in the vineyard valley is a must. This medieval village, nestled among vineyards, offers a sensory delight with its exquisite wines and stunning views.
